Security Service Providers in Schweizer-Reneke, North West
Security services in Schweizer-Reneke, a rural town in the North West Province of South Africa, are shaped by local priorities such as farm security, commercial premises, residential estates, and small to medium-sized businesses. Providers in the area typically offer a range of protective and investigative capabilities designed to deter crime, respond to incidents, and support peace of mind for communities and enterprises. The emphasis is often on practical, scalable solutions that suit the town’s road networks, access points, and surrounding countryside.
Common offerings include manned guarding for retail premises, offices and warehouses, supplemented by mobile patrols that traverse residential streets and outlying properties. These services aim to maintain a visible presence, deter potential intruders, and provide rapid response in the event of suspicious activity or emergencies. For commercial sites, guarding may extend to visitor management, patrol routing, and incident logging to support ongoing security oversight.
Another core element involves electronic security systems. CCTV surveillance installations, access control for controlled entrances, and alarm systems frequently form the backbone of protection for both small businesses and larger sites. In Schweizer-Reneke, systems are commonly tailored to the specific site layout, with consideration given to lighting, blind spots, and the need for remote monitoring where feasible. Where possible, security providers coordinate with local control rooms or reputable monitoring centres to ensure timely notification of authorities and rapid on-site verification of alarms.
Residential security is also a priority in many neighbourhoods, where providers may offer home alarm packages, key-cutting and locksmithing referrals, and bespoke advisory visits to assess vulnerability and recommended improvements. For farms and rural properties, security offerings often include perimeter fencing advice, farm patrols, and quick-response capabilities to address livestock protections, access gates, and remote outbuildings. The aim is to address both human and property risks that arise from rural living and agricultural activity.
Security service provisions in Schweizer-Reneke typically begin with a site assessment or consultation. During this process, the client’s property layout, access points, and potential risk factors are reviewed. The resulting plan usually covers staffing arrangements, patrol schedules, and a layered security approach that might combine visible deterrence with electronic detection and rapid response. Clear communication channels and agreed escalation procedures are standard components, ensuring that clients understand how incidents will be handled and by what timelines.
Customers can expect a pragmatic approach to governance and compliance. Reputable providers emphasise the importance of safeguarding personal data and maintaining professional conduct, while aligning with local regulations and industry best practices. Reliability, visible presence, and timely responsiveness are frequently highlighted as key performance indicators. In addition, ongoing maintenance for alarms, cameras, and access systems is commonly offered on an as-needed or preventive basis to minimise downtime and prolong equipment life.
Practical considerations for engaging security services in Schweizer-Reneke include assessing the property’s risk profile, budget constraints, and preferred levels of protection. Clients are advised to discuss incident reporting, documentation, and how security personnel will coordinate with local law enforcement when required. It is prudent to review service level agreements to specify response times, patrol frequency, and the expectations around site handover after shifts or events. Overall, the choice of provider typically hinges on the combination of reliable presence, compatible technology, and a clear, collaborative approach to safeguarding people and property in the Schweizer-Reneke community.
